Surat : Kiran Hospital under fire after 9-month-old girl’s death sparks negligence allegations

SURAT: One of Surat’s leading private healthcare institutions, Kiran Hospital, has landed in fresh controversy after the death of a nine-month-old baby girl triggered serious allegations of medical negligence. The grieving family has accused doctors and nursing staff of fatal lapses during treatment, leading to a dramatic protest inside the hospital and a police investigation.

The deceased, Krishna Chaudhary, daughter of Miteshbhai and Kirtika Chaudhary of Katargam’s Khodiyar Krupa Society, was admitted to the hospital on July 11 after her health deteriorated. According to the family, the infant had undergone a valve surgery and was recovering well until an incident during treatment allegedly changed everything.

The family claims the baby’s condition suddenly worsened immediately after a needle inserted in her neck was removed by a member of the nursing staff. Despite emergency efforts by hospital personnel, Krishna died shortly afterwards.

“My daughter was recovering after the surgery. A nurse removed the needle from her neck, and within minutes her condition became critical. She never recovered,” alleged Kirtika Miteshbhai Chaudhary, the baby’s mother, while breaking down before the media.

She further claimed that the procedure was not carried out by the operating doctor or a senior medical professional, raising serious questions about the standard of care provided.

The baby’s death shattered the family, whose first child was widely described as the centre of their lives. Angry relatives gathered inside the hospital, accusing the management of gross negligence and demanding that the surgeon who treated the child appear before them. The protest created tense scenes within the hospital premises.

Following the unrest, Katargam police reached the hospital and brought the situation under control. Police officials said an inquiry has been initiated into the allegations.

“The operating doctor is currently out of Surat. He will be questioned after his return. Further action will be taken based on the medical records, expert opinion and the findings of the investigation,” a police official said.

Kiran Hospital has not yet issued an official statement responding to the allegations.
